近年来,随着计算机技术的飞速发展,深度学习在各个领域都取得了显著的成果。其中,DeepFlow技术在流体模拟中的应用更是成为了学术界和工业界的焦点。本文将详细介绍DeepFlow技术的原理、优势以及在流体模拟中的应用,以期为相关领域的研究者提供有益的参考。
一、DeepFlow技术简介
DeepFlow是一种基于深度学习的流体模拟方法,它利用神经网络对流体运动进行建模和预测。与传统的基于物理的流体模拟方法相比,DeepFlow具有以下特点:
无需复杂的物理模型:DeepFlow不需要对流体运动的物理过程进行精确描述,从而简化了建模过程。
高效的计算:DeepFlow在训练过程中通过大量的数据学习流体运动的规律,使得模拟过程具有较高的计算效率。
广泛的应用场景:DeepFlow可以应用于各种流体模拟场景,如流体-固体耦合、多相流、湍流等。
二、DeepFlow技术原理
DeepFlow技术主要基于以下原理:
神经网络结构:DeepFlow采用卷积神经网络(CNN)对流体运动进行建模。CNN能够自动提取流体图像中的特征,从而实现流体运动的预测。
流体运动建模:DeepFlow将流体运动分解为一系列的微元,通过神经网络对每个微元的运动进行建模,从而实现对整个流体运动的预测。
训练过程:DeepFlow在训练过程中,利用大量的流体运动数据进行学习,通过优化神经网络参数,提高流体模拟的精度。
三、DeepFlow技术在流体模拟中的应用
流体-固体耦合模拟:在流体-固体耦合模拟中,DeepFlow技术可以有效地模拟流体与固体之间的相互作用。例如,在模拟船舶航行过程中,DeepFlow可以预测水流对船体的影响,从而优化船舶的设计。
多相流模拟:DeepFlow技术在多相流模拟中具有显著优势。例如,在模拟石油开采过程中,DeepFlow可以预测油、水、气三相之间的相互作用,为油气田开发提供有力支持。
湍流模拟:湍流是一种复杂的流体运动现象,传统模拟方法难以准确描述。DeepFlow技术通过学习大量的湍流数据,能够实现对湍流的准确模拟,为航空航天、气象预报等领域提供技术支持。
生物流体模拟:在生物医学领域,DeepFlow技术可以用于模拟血液流动、细胞运动等现象。例如,在研究心血管疾病时,DeepFlow可以预测血流动力学变化,为疾病诊断和治疗提供依据。
四、总结
DeepFlow技术在流体模拟中的应用为相关领域的研究提供了新的思路和方法。随着深度学习技术的不断发展,DeepFlow技术将在更多领域发挥重要作用。未来,DeepFlow技术有望在以下方面取得进一步突破:
提高模拟精度:通过优化神经网络结构和训练方法,提高DeepFlow技术在流体模拟中的精度。
扩展应用场景:将DeepFlow技术应用于更多领域,如海洋工程、环境工程等。
跨学科研究:与物理、化学、生物学等学科相结合,开展跨学科研究,推动流体模拟技术的创新与发展。